A smart watch with WiFi and SIM card 4G is a watch that can connect to the internet via WiFi or a mobile data plan. Normally, these watches fall into two distinct categories based on connectivity: watches with Wi-Fi connectivity only and cellular-enabled watches that support SIM cards.
Watches with Wi-Fi Connectivity Only:
These 4G smart watches with WiFi and SIM cards don't have a SIM card slot. They can only connect to the internet via a standalone Wi-Fi network. Consequently, when out of Wi-Fi's reassuring range, the watch becomes a mere timepiece and fitness tracker. However, within a Wi-Fi network's reach, users can enjoy syncing notifications, messages, and calls with their phones, downloading apps, and even participating in video calls.
Cellular-Enabled Watches:
These smartwatches with SIM card slots function as independent devices. They are equipped with a 4G LTE connection feature, allowing the watch to remain connected to the internet without necessitating the user's smartphone to be within proximity. These watches allow users to receive and send notifications, messages, and calls even while not carrying their phones. They typically come with a SIM card slot, which can accommodate a nano-SIM or eSIM card, enabling them to have a dedicated mobile data plan.

Health and Fitness Tracking:
Smartwatches with SIM cards have a number of health-oriented features. These features typically include sensors such as pedometers to monitor and count steps taken, heart rate sensors to keep track of the wearer's heartbeat and a sleep monitor to keep tabs on the wearer when they sleep. All three features combined can promote the wearer's overall health and well-being by encouraging physical activity, monitoring vital signs, and improving sleep quality.
GPS Functionality:
The 4G smart watch that takes SIM cards has a built-in GPS functionality, which serves many purposes. Activities such as hiking, walking, and other outdoor activities can be tracked. This information can help analyze and improve performance in areas such as distance covered, speed, and other pertinent data. Additionally, the GPS functionality allows for real-time location tracking to occur. This is important because it contributes to the overall safety of the watch wearer. In the event of an emergency, the wearer's location can be easily identified and help can be sent. Not to mention, features like geofencing and route tracking can aid in navigation and help with getting directions. All of these functions work together to enhance the wearer's experience and promote their safety while engaging in outdoor and active lifestyles.

Voice Assistance and Messaging:
Voice messaging, dial pads for sending texts, and voice assistance for making calls are all essential features of smartwatches. Voice messaging allows users to send and receive messages through recorded voice messages. This feature provides a convenient way to communicate hands-free. A dial pad for sending texts enables users to type messages directly on the smartwatch. Despite the small screen size, thanks to the predictive text input and emoji integration, this feature makes it possible to send texts quickly and easily. Voice assistance for making calls is another important feature of smartwatches. With voice commands, users can easily place calls to contacts without having to navigate through menus or dial numbers manually. Voice assistance makes it easy to stay connected with friends and family.

4G smart watches with Wi-Fi and SIM cards come in various models. Before buying this type of watch in bulk, here are some things to consider.
Design and Display
The design of the watch is the first thing clients will notice. So, look for watches with a modern or stylish design. These watches should have changeable straps to fit different wears. Also, check the display type and size. AMOLED displays provide sharper images, while LCD screens are easier to produce at a low cost. Buyers may prefer watches with larger displays, as they offer a better user experience.
Processor and Battery Life
Check the processing power of the smart watch. Models with strong processors run apps smoothly and offer efficient network connectivity. Also, consider how long the battery lasts on a single charge. Choose watches with longer battery life, as they need less maintenance and are more appealing to clients.
Health Monitoring Features
Watches with health monitoring features provide excellent value for buyers. Some basic features include heart rate monitoring, blood pressure checking, sleep monitoring, pedometer, and sensor-child safety. 4G smart watches with Wi-Fi and SIM cards that have health monitoring sensors for women can detect hormonal changes and track menstrual cycles.
Connectivity Options and Operating System
Buyers will use the 4G SIM card smart watch to connect to their smartphones. So, ensure the watch supports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, and 4G or LTE connectivity. Also, check the watchOS. Users with Android smartphones will prefer watches that support Android operating systems or offer compatibility. iOS users will look for watches that support the watchOS system.
Water Resistance and Other Features
Finally, buyers may use the 4G-enabled smart watch in different environments. To avoid potential issues, choose water-resistant (IP67 or IP68) watches. Add watches with dustproof features to the water-resistant models. Other features to check include shockproof design, GPS navigation, positioning, voice assistant, remote camera control, messaging, and calling capabilities.
Q: What benefits does 4G connectivity provide to a smart watch with WiFi and SIM card?
A: 4G connectivity allows the smartwatch to access data services, make calls, and send texts. It gives the watch phone-like capabilities. Buyers can receive notifications, alerts, and emails and stay connected even without the phone.
Q: Can a 4G smartwatch work without a phone?
A: Yes, the 4G watch can work independently with its SIM card. However, features like receiving notifications and alerts need the phone for initial setup and continued operation.
Q: Can the 4G smartwatch be used for outdoor activities and fitness?
A: 4G watches are suitable for outdoor and fitness use. They have built-in GPS for accurate location tracking and navigation. Some models have water resistance and rugged designs made for active lifestyles.
Q: What precautions should be taken when using 4G smartwatches?
A: Users should take care to protect the watch’s screen from scratches and damage. Keeping the watch software updated is also important for security and optimal performance. When using the watch for payments, it is important to use it only at trusted terminals.
